企业选择CentOS:版本选择的深度剖析
结论:
在企业环境中,选择合适的CentOS版本至关重要。尽管每个版本都有其独特的特性和优势,但综合考虑稳定性和支持期限,CentOS 8 Stream或CentOS Linux 7是目前企业最常采用的选择。然而,由于Red Hat对CentOS项目策略的调整,未来企业可能需要转向AlmaLinux、Rocky Linux等CentOS替代品。
正文:
CentOS,全称为Community ENTerprise Operating System,是一款基于RHEL(Red Hat Enterprise Linux)源代码重新编译的开源操作系统,以其稳定性、安全性以及与RHEL的高度兼容性而备受企业青睐。然而,选择哪个版本并非易事,因为它涉及到企业的IT策略、应用兼容性、维护成本和长期支持等多个因素。
首先,CentOS 7是当前广泛使用的一个版本,它的生命周期到2024年6月30日,这意味着企业有足够的时间进行迁移或升级,而且其成熟的技术栈和广泛的社区支持使得它在企业中具有很高的接受度。尤其是对于那些运行旧应用程序或者依赖于旧库的企业,CentOS 7是一个理想的选择。
然而,CentOS 8的引入带来了新的变化。CentOS 8 Stream更注重开发者的体验,提供了最新的软件包和更新,为企业提供了更快地获取新功能和安全修复的途径。尽管生命周期较短,但适合对技术更新需求较高的企业。然而,由于2021年底CentOS 8的提前退役,这个选择现在可能不再适用于寻求长期稳定性的企业。
由于Red Hat宣布CentOS Linux 8将在2021年底结束支持,企业需要重新评估他们的操作系统策略。这导致了AlmaLinux和Rocky Linux等CentOS替代品的兴起,它们旨在提供与RHEL的1:1兼容性和长期支持,为企业提供了新的选择。
AlmaLinux和Rocky Linux都是由社区驱动的,且承诺提供至少至2029年的支持,这为需要长期稳定性的企业提供了一个可靠的平台。这两个版本在功能、性能和安全性上与CentOS相似,且已有许多企业开始迁移,这预示着它们可能会成为未来企业的新宠。
总的来说,企业在选择CentOS版本时应考虑自身的业务需求、技术栈、维护成本和长期规划。对于寻求稳定性的企业,CentOS Linux 7可能是最后的机会,而对于愿意尝试新功能并快速适应变化的企业,AlmaLinux和Rocky Linux可能是未来的方向。无论选择哪个版本,关键在于确保选择能够满足企业当前和未来需求的操作系统。
CCLOUD博客